-- | Information about a source configuration.
--
-- /See:/ 'newSourceConfig' smart constructor.
data SourceConfig = SourceConfig'
{ -- | The target processor architecture for the application.
architecture :: Prelude.Maybe Architecture,
-- | The Amazon S3 bucket name.
s3Bucket :: Prelude.Maybe Prelude.Text,
-- | The s3 object key.
s3Key :: Prelude.Maybe Prelude.Text
}
deriving (Prelude.Eq, Prelude.Read, Prelude.Show, Prelude.Generic)
-- |
-- Create a value of 'SourceConfig' with all optional fields omitted.
--
-- Use <https://hackage.haskell.org/package/generic-lens generic-lens> or <https://hackage.haskell.org/package/optics optics> to modify other optional fields.
--
-- The following record fields are available, with the corresponding lenses provided
-- for backwards compatibility:
--
-- 'architecture', 'sourceConfig_architecture' - The target processor architecture for the application.
--
-- 's3Bucket', 'sourceConfig_s3Bucket' - The Amazon S3 bucket name.
--
-- 's3Key', 'sourceConfig_s3Key' - The s3 object key.
newSourceConfig ::
SourceConfig
newSourceConfig =
SourceConfig'
{ architecture = Prelude.Nothing,
s3Bucket = Prelude.Nothing,
s3Key = Prelude.Nothing
}
-- | The target processor architecture for the application.
sourceConfig_architecture :: Lens.Lens' SourceConfig (Prelude.Maybe Architecture)
sourceConfig_architecture = Lens.lens (\SourceConfig' {architecture} -> architecture) (\s@SourceConfig' {} a -> s {architecture = a} :: SourceConfig)
-- | The Amazon S3 bucket name.
sourceConfig_s3Bucket :: Lens.Lens' SourceConfig (Prelude.Maybe Prelude.Text)
sourceConfig_s3Bucket = Lens.lens (\SourceConfig' {s3Bucket} -> s3Bucket) (\s@SourceConfig' {} a -> s {s3Bucket = a} :: SourceConfig)
-- | The s3 object key.
sourceConfig_s3Key :: Lens.Lens' SourceConfig (Prelude.Maybe Prelude.Text)
sourceConfig_s3Key = Lens.lens (\SourceConfig' {s3Key} -> s3Key) (\s@SourceConfig' {} a -> s {s3Key = a} :: SourceConfig)
instance Prelude.Hashable SourceConfig where
hashWithSalt _salt SourceConfig' {..} =
_salt
`Prelude.hashWithSalt` architecture
`Prelude.hashWithSalt` s3Bucket
`Prelude.hashWithSalt` s3Key
instance Prelude.NFData SourceConfig where
rnf SourceConfig' {..} =
Prelude.rnf architecture
`Prelude.seq` Prelude.rnf s3Bucket
`Prelude.seq` Prelude.rnf s3Key
instance Data.ToJSON SourceConfig where
toJSON SourceConfig' {..} =
Data.object
( Prelude.catMaybes
[ ("architecture" Data..=) Prelude.<$> architecture,
("s3Bucket" Data..=) Prelude.<$> s3Bucket,
("s3Key" Data..=) Prelude.<$> s3Key
]
)
